Tata Savaiinaea 1902 - 1980

Tata Savaiinaea of Honolulu, Honolulu County, Hawaii was born on August 17, 1902, and died at age 77 years old in January 1980.

In 1913, when this person was only 11 years old, ratified in February the 16th Amendment, establishing a Federal income tax, became law. Previously, customs duties (tariffs) and excise taxes were the primary sources of federal revenue. With the passage of the 16th Amendment, incomes of couples exceeding $4,000, as well as those of single persons earning $3,000 or more, were subject to a 1% Federal tax (that would be about $98,000 and $74,000 now). Rates rose to 7% for incomes over half a million dollars. Less than 1% of the population was subject to income tax.
